This project comprised the creation of a mental health facility which included 12 bed, semi-secure accommodation with short-term break facility and a unit that provides specialist sensory therapy, group therapy and consultation rooms. M & E Services provided include a passenger lift, CCTV, security, access control, lighting, power, pinpoint 600 staff attack. Above ground drainage, heating and ventilation, hot and cold water with remote electronic isolation, and hydrotherapy unit were also provided. |
